In humans, cyanocobalamin must undergo intracellular enzymatic conversion to the active coenzyme formsmethylcobalamin and adenosylcobalaminwhich, depending on the pH environment, can interconvert with hydroxocobalamin ( Despite extensive biochemical knowledge of cobalamin metabolism and its physiological importance, the optimal supplementation route for maintaining or restoring adequate vitamin B12 levels remains debated
